    Sarasota Memorial Hospital (SMH) is a publicly owned 901-bed health care facility located in Sarasota, Florida. [2] It was founded in 1925. The health care facility is a level II trauma center [ 3 ] and the flagship facility of the Sarasota Memorial Health Care System, which services Sarasota and Manatee counties. [ 4 ]

    Surrey Memorial is the second-largest hospital in British Columbia and has the busiest emergency department. As of 2019, SMH provides service to over 158,558 emergency department patients per year, making it the second busiest in Canada. [1]

    Springfield Memorial Hospital (SMH) is a 500-bed non-profit teaching hospital located in Springfield, Illinois. Founded in 1897, [4] Springfield Memorial Hospital is one of two hospitals in the Springfield metropolitan area. It also is home to the Memorial Center for Learning and Innovation, a 72,000-square-foot educational learning center. [5]

    Strong Memorial Hospital (SMH) is an 886-bed medical facility, [1] part of the University of Rochester Medical Center complex, in Rochester, New York, United States.Opened in 1926, it is a major provider of both in-patient and out-patient medical services.

    Saint Mary's Hospital (abbreviated STMH) is a Yale-affiliated [2] urban hospital located at 56 Franklin Street, Waterbury, Connecticut.Operated by Trinity Health, it was founded in 1907 by the Sisters of Saint Joseph of Chambéry and is designated as a Level II trauma center.

    www.smh-hq.org The Society for Military History is a United States–based international organization of scholars who research, write, and teach military history of all time periods and places. It includes naval history , air power history , and studies of technology, ideas, and homefronts.
